About us

Maghenta is an international organisation for artists, art practitioners, programmers, scholars and art lovers who have an affinity for innovation through Indian arts. We strongly believe in the power of the arts as a remedy, with the ability to arouse positive curiosity about another culture, and to stimulate collaboration free of prejudice.

 

 

 

OUR MISSION

Maghenta creates visibility for

  • Indian inspired performances within the cultural and artistic scene in Belgium in particular, but also on an international level
  • contemporary artistic work in India

Maghenta builds an unique 'bridge of exchange' between

  • contemporary and traditional arts
  • art, academics and the corporate world
  • multiple artists from mainly Belgium and India

 

Laura Neyskens

Laura Neyskens

Founder & Creative Director
Laura Neyskens put her first foot on stage at the early age of 11, touring extensively all over Europe. She discovered traveling and performing to be her greatest passion, and soon joined the contemporary dance company of Alain Platel (1998). There she met the young dancer Sidi Larbi Cherkaoui, which marked the beginning of a long collaboration. Next to dancing in several of his dance productions (2000-2019), she also featured in his company as rehearsal director and choreographer. Since 2017 she frequently works with the Belgian director Chokri Ben Chikha, as assistant and choreographer of his company. Meanwhile, for over 18 years Laura has been developing an interest in Indian dance, which resulted in co-founding the dance collective Bollylicious (2015). Putting together her contemporary dance and Indian dance background, she takes this project a step further by creating Maghenta.
Ayla Joncheere

Dr. Ayla Joncheere

Founder & Creative Director
Ayla Joncheere took her first Indian dance class at the age of 12. Due to her interest in Indian dance, she decided to study "Indian Languages ​​and Cultures" at Ghent university. She obtained a PhD in the same subject (2016). Her research project (2012 - 2016) was entitled: Kālbeliyās - Dancers, Gypsies or Snake Charmers: Staging of Authenticity and Dynamics of Identity. During her PhD, she specialised in dance anthropology and heritage studies. She is fluent in Hindi and is currently still working as a post-doctoral researcher at Ghent University. In the meantime she has emerged as an international expert of the dance and music traditions from Rajasthan. She leads various research groups, conferences and projects in and around Rajasthan, such as Kalbeliya World. In addition to her academic career, she has always remained active as a dancer and choreographer in Bollylicious, continuing to develop her organisational and business skills. This cocktail of research, arts and management led to the founding of Maghenta, which she passionately leads together with her colleague, Laura.
